Company Description:
- Fives, an industrial engineering group, designs and supplies machines, process equipment, and production lines for the world's largest industrial players.
- The company's multisector expertise provides a global vision of industries and markets that yields a continuous source of innovation.
- Fives' R&D programs design forward-thinking industrial solutions that anticipate clients' needs in terms of profitability, safety, while maintaining compliance with environmental standards.
- The company aims to be a benchmark player in the development of the plant of the future.
